Transaction 52d03d3dd9e3210a71c980cdfd35cea49097f0b19c6767fbc9abe88ddce8bb21

block
eb8fc5546ac5b06393934f177345061e52682439ee4b1f5c412a3b20f61deb26

1 Input

21 Outputs